A British Airways pilot was sacked from his job after allegedly snorting cocaine before he was due to fly a plane back to London.
An air hostess raised the alarm after the pilot, Mike Beaton, texted her to brag about his night of partying.
UK correspondent says the air hostess clearly felt the need to alert authorities about possible risks to the passengers.
